In 2006, Wagenbrenner Management Company implemented Intuit Quickbooks Enterprise. The deployment targeted core accounting and project finance functions under the ERP Financial category to support its construction and real estate operations. The implementation configured Intuit Quickbooks Enterprise to handle core modules common to ERP Financial systems, including general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ll, job costing, inventory and financial reporting. Configuration emphasis was on a construction and real estate oriented chart of accounts and job costing structures, enabling project-level revenue and expense capture, cost categorization for materials and labor, and consolidated period reporting. Architecturally the deployment established multi-user financial processing and role based permissions to separate accounting, project accounting and operations responsibilities. The system centralized transactional posting into a single general ledger, while job costing workflows collected site level transactions for aggregation into project financials and standard reporting. Governance and process changes focused on standardized accounting workflows, defined month end close and reconciliation routines, and the introduction of audit trails and user access controls to support internal financial controls. Training and operational rollout centered on accounting staff and project managers to align job costing practices with company financial reporting under Intuit Quickbooks Enterprise.

In 2015, Wagenbrenner Management Company implemented Help Scout to provide Customer Support directly through its corporate website. The deployment uses Help Scout's web-facing conversation channel and embedded support widget to capture tenant and prospect inquiries, with centralized inbox handling, shared conversation assignment, and contextual customer profiles typical of Customer Support platforms. The implementation scope targets customer-facing property management and leasing functions within the company's U.S. operations and aligns with a 50-person staffing model. Configuration emphasized standard Help Scout capabilities including shared inbox workflows, tagging, threaded conversations, and a knowledge base for repeatable responses, with agent routing calibrated for a small corporate support team. Governance established operational ownership by customer service and property operations leaders, defined response workflows, and a site-level rollout that places the Help Scout widget across public-facing property pages on the company's website. Wagenbrenner Management Company uses Help Scout for Customer Support to centralize inquiry capture and streamline customer response processes.
